Welcome to Arrowhead Pride’s 2026 NFL Draft live blog for Day 2, as we cover Round 2 and Round 3 from Pittsburgh, Pennsylavania.
On Friday night, TV coverage will be provided by NFL Network, ESPN and ESPN Deportesbeginning at 6 p.m. Arrowhead Time. That coverage will also be streamed on *NFL+and ESPN+. ABC will have coverage (locally on KMBC/9) beginning at 6 p.m. Arrowhead Time.*You can also listen on SiriusXM and ESPN Radio.
Here we will bring you Jared Sapp’s live updates regarding Kansas City Chiefs rumors, pick reactions, trade updates, hot takes and more — while also providing for discussion in the comments.
We will focus on the most important moves affecting Kansas City — as well as coverage of local prospects, happenings among AFC West foes and the draft’s biggest stories.
After a slew of trades to close round one, Friday night is scheduled to begin with picks by the San Francisco 49ers, Arizona Cardinals, , , and . After a round one trade up for cornerback Mansoor Delane, the Chiefs are scheduled to have only pick No. 40 on Friday night.
